

Margie Marie Carter, age 84 of Kingsport, was welcomed into Heaven by her Lord and Savior on December 24, 2015. Margie was born to the late William Musser and the late Annie Mae Morely Musser on April 2, 1931 in Sullivan County, TN. Margie married Jesse Hubert Carter and after 59 years of a happy marriage, he preceded her in death in 2007. Margie loved sewing and spending time outdoors. She was a devout Christian and she could often be found reading her favorite book of all, The Holy Bible. Margie was a housewife for her entire adult life; raising her children was one of her top priorities in life.
